## Limits and Quotas

Fabrikette, our test-data factory library, enforces hard caps on generated records to keep CI runs predictable. Reviewers should confirm that any new factory respects the per-suite quota and does not override the global ceiling without a comment explaining why. Exceeding the nested-association depth limit raises immediately rather than truncating, so watch for suppressed exceptions in fixtures. All limits are centralized in one module for auditability. The current tuning constants are listed below.

constants for fajop-tahaf:
RATE_LIMITS = {
    "holael": 2,
    "oliael": 10,
    "druael": 10,
    "wenwyn": 10,
}

## Further Reading

Plugin authors extending Pairlattice should understand how our matcher's generational collector behaves under burst load, since callbacks scheduled during a major pause may be deferred beyond your configured timeout. We keep detailed pause histograms, tuning flags, and a worked example of safe callback budgeting on an internal page maintained by the runtime team.

operations page: https://confluence.nelvroworks.example/dash/spaces/board/job/pipeline/issue/spaces/b9c0f0fbc164027c4eb481af

Ticket #VAULT-LOCK: GPU profiler plugin keys inaccessible

Plugin authors building against the Memtrace SDK currently cannot fetch signing keys because the Kilnworth vault auto-locked after three failed attempts. Until the rotation job is fixed, manual unsealing is the only path. Please unseal carefully and re-lock afterward. The vault accepts the recovery passphrase below.

unlock words, yagep-fahof: belix-rusvan-casdor-gorox-aldath-norael-istix-quenael-fraeth-silael